The map of developmental degree of desertification in Daqinggou, Keerqin (Horqin) Steppe, Inner Mongolia, China(1981)

The data is digitized from a drawing, the map of developmental degree of desertification in Daqinggou, Keerqin (HORQIN) Steppe (1981). The specific information of this map is as follows:

* Chief Editor: Zhu Zhenda

* Editor: Feng Yusun

* Drawer: Feng Yusun, Yao Fafen, Wang Jianhua, Zhao Yanhua, Li Weimin

* Mapping unit: Prepared by Desert Research Office, Chinese Academy of Sciences

* Publisher: No

* Scale: 1: 50000

* Publication time: No

* Legend: Gully Dense Forest, Sparse Woods, Brush, Artificial Woodland, Nursery and Vegetable Garden, Grass Land, Dry Farmland (Dry Farmland), Rejected Farmland, Marsh Land, Shifting Snad-Dunes, Semi-Shifting Sand-Dunes, Semi-Fixed Sand-Dunes ), Fixed Sand-Dunes, Water Area, Rice, Residential, Highway

1. File format and naming

The data is stored in ESRI Shapefile format, including the following layers:

Desertification map of Daqinggou area in Horqin steppe, rivers, swamps, roads, lakes, residential areas

2. Data desertification attribute fields:

Type of desertification (Shape), Grassland (Grassland), Woodland (Woodland), Woodland Density (W_density), Farmland (Farmland)

3. Projection information:

Angular Unit: Degree (0.017453292519943295)

Prime Meridian: Greenwich (0.000000000000000000)

Datum: D_Beijing_1954

Spheroid: Krasovsky_1940

Semimajor Axis: 6378245.000000000000000000

Semiminor Axis: 6356863.018773047300000000

Inverse Flattening: 298.300000000000010000


File naming and required software

The data is stored in vector SHP format and can be opened and read by remote sensing software such as ArcGIS and QGIS
